If the new moon happens on January 15th, what shape will it be on February 6th?

-- From January 15 to February 6 is a period of 22 days.

-- The period of the full cycle of moon phases is 29.53 days.

-- So those dates represent (22/29.53) = 74.5% of a full cycle of phases.

-- That's almost exactly 3/4 of a full cycle, so on February 6, the moon would be almost exactly at Third Quarter. That's the left half of a disk (viewed from the northern hemisphere).
